Partner MinistriesChrist Church partners with several ministries in Broward County and across the globe. Please visit these ministries' sites at the links below.
+ Rocketown: A 12,000 square foot non-profit entertainment facility on Federal Highway consisting of a music venue, cafe, recreation, and programming. Rocketown provides a safe, alcohol and drug free environment for youth to enjoy concerts, classes, video games and much more.
+ The Shepherd's Way: A Christian ministry providing housing, support, and mentoring for homeless families in Broward County. Homeless families are provided housing at The Shepherd's Way Family Shelter in Wilton Manors.
+ The Harbour Church: A congregation that worships in the Gym at our Pompano Beach Ministry Center.
+ Taylor's Closet: A store-like environment where girls "at risk" can shop for designer clothes and accessories
—completely free of charge
—in order to feel the love of Jesus. Taylor's Closet is housed at our Pompano Beach Ministry Center.
+ Global Orphan Project: A Christian organization that is transforming lives through orphan care across the globe.
+ South Florida Urban Ministry: A non-profit organization that empowers people to move from poverty to prosperity through holistic youth development, small business development, and hunger relief ministries in South Florida.
+ 4Kids of South Florida: A child welfare agency dedicated to meeting the needs of foster care children by placing them in a protective environment that offers love and support.
+ God Speaks: A Christian organization that places simple, scriptural messages from God on highway billboards.
+ Compassion International: One of the nation's largest Christian child-sponsorship organizations, working with more than 65 denominations and thousands of indigenous church partners in Africa, Asia, Central and South America, and the Caribbean.
+ The Vine International Ministries—Igreja Videira
: A Portuguese-language congregation reaching out to the Brazilian community in Broward County.
+ God's Little Lambs: A Christian child care center that has an enrollment of up to 65 children each day. All the children come from impoverished families that qualify for state assistance.
